Skip to content

Commit 4acff54

Browse files
author
webra2
committed
Message here
1 parent 5176a31 commit 4acff54

22 files changed

Lines changed: 4770 additions & 658 deletions

VERSION

Lines changed: 19 additions & 35 deletions
Original file line numberDiff line numberDiff line change
@@ -1,35 +1,19 @@
1-
<!doctype html>
2-
<html>
3-
<head>
4-
<meta charset="utf-8">
5-
<meta name="robots" content="noindex, nofollow">
6-
<title>One moment, please...</title>
7-
<style>
8-
body {
9-
background: #F6F7F8;
10-
color: #303131;
11-
font-family: sans-serif;
12-
margin-top: 45vh;
13-
text-align: center;
14-
}
15-
</style>
16-
</head>
17-
<body>
18-
<h1>Please wait while your request is being verified...</h1>
19-
<form id="wsidchk-form" style="display:none;" action="/z0f76a1d14fd21a8fb5fd0d03e0fdc3d3cedae52f" method="get">
20-
<input type="hidden" id="wsidchk" name="wsidchk"/>
21-
</form>
22-
<script>
23-
(function(){
24-
var west=+((+!+[])+(+!+[]+!![]+!![]+!![]+!![]+!![]+[])+(+!+[]+!![]+!![])+(+![]+[])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![])+(+!+[]+[])+(+!+[]+!![]+!![]+!![]+!![])+(+!+[]+!![]+!![]+!![]+[])),
25-
east=+((+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![])+(+!+[]+!![]+!![]+!![]+!![]+[])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![])+(+!+[]+!![]+!![]+!![]+[])+(+!+[]+!![])+(+!+[]+!![]+[])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![])),
26-
x=function(){try{return !!window.addEventListener;}catch(e){return !!0;} },
27-
y=function(y,z){x() ? document.addEventListener("DOMContentLoaded",y,z) : document.attachEvent("onreadystatechange",y);};
28-
y(function(){
29-
document.getElementById('wsidchk').value = west + east;
30-
document.getElementById('wsidchk-form').submit();
31-
}, false);
32-
})();
33-
</script>
34-
</body>
35-
</html>
1+
{
2+
"0.40": "0.40.6",
3+
"0.41": "0.41.7",
4+
"0.42": "0.42.3",
5+
"0.43": "0.43.0",
6+
"0.44": "0.44.0",
7+
"0.45": "0.45.1",
8+
"0.46": "0.46.3",
9+
"0.47": "0.47.1",
10+
"0.48": "0.48.0",
11+
"0.49": "0.49.0",
12+
"0.50": "0.50.2",
13+
"0.51": "0.51.1",
14+
"0.52": "0.52.1",
15+
"0.53": "0.53.0",
16+
"0.54": "0.54.1",
17+
"0.55": "0.55.7",
18+
"0.56": "0.56.0"
19+
}

dist/ffmped-core.js

Lines changed: 53 additions & 34 deletions
Original file line numberDiff line numberDiff line change
@@ -1,35 +1,54 @@
1-
<!doctype html>
2-
<html>
3-
<head>
4-
<meta charset="utf-8">
5-
<meta name="robots" content="noindex, nofollow">
6-
<title>One moment, please...</title>
7-
<style>
8-
body {
9-
background: #F6F7F8;
10-
color: #303131;
11-
font-family: sans-serif;
12-
margin-top: 45vh;
13-
text-align: center;
14-
}
15-
</style>
16-
</head>
17-
<body>
18-
<h1>Please wait while your request is being verified...</h1>
19-
<form id="wsidchk-form" style="display:none;" action="/z0f76a1d14fd21a8fb5fd0d03e0fdc3d3cedae52f" method="get">
20-
<input type="hidden" id="wsidchk" name="wsidchk"/>
21-
</form>
22-
<script>
23-
(function(){
24-
var west=+((+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![]+!![])+(+!+[]+!![]+!![]+[])+(+!+[]+!![]+!![]+!![]+!![]+!![])+(+!+[]+!![]+!![]+[])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![]+!![])+(+![]+[])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![])),
25-
east=+((+!+[])+(+!+[]+[])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![])+(+!+[]+!![]+!![]+[])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![]+!![])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![]+[])+(+!+[]+!![]+!![])+(+!+[]+!![]+!![]+!![]+!![]+!![]+[])),
26-
x=function(){try{return !!window.addEventListener;}catch(e){return !!0;} },
27-
y=function(y,z){x() ? document.addEventListener("DOMContentLoaded",y,z) : document.attachEvent("onreadystatechange",y);};
28-
y(function(){
29-
document.getElementById('wsidchk').value = west + east;
30-
document.getElementById('wsidchk-form').submit();
31-
}, false);
32-
})();
33-
</script>
34-
</body>
1+
2+
3+
4+
<!DOCTYPE html>
5+
<html>
6+
<head>
7+
<title>404 Not Found</title>
8+
<meta http-equiv="Content-type" content="text/html; charset=utf-8">
9+
<meta http-equiv="Cache-control" content="no-cache">
10+
<meta http-equiv="Pragma" content="no-cache">
11+
<meta http-equiv="Expires" content="0">
12+
<link rel="shortcut icon" href="/favicon.ico" type="image/x-icon">
13+
<link rel="icon" href="/favicon.ico" type="image/x-icon">
14+
<style type="text/css">
15+
html, body {
16+
height: 100%;
17+
margin: 0;
18+
}
19+
body {
20+
color: yellow;
21+
background: black url(img/soviet-logo.png) no-repeat center center;
22+
}
23+
.overlay {
24+
width: 100%;
25+
height: 100%;
26+
background-color: rgba(0, 0, 0, .75);
27+
}
28+
.error {
29+
position: fixed;
30+
top: 50%;
31+
left: 50%;
32+
transform: translateX(-50%) translateY(-50%);
33+
font-family: Arial, Helvetica, sans-serif;
34+
text-align: center;
35+
}
36+
.error h1 {
37+
margin: 0;
38+
font-size: 2rem;
39+
}
40+
.error p {
41+
margin: 0;
42+
margin-top: 1rem;
43+
}
44+
</style>
45+
</head>
46+
<body>
47+
<div class="overlay">
48+
<div class="error">
49+
<h1>404 Not Found</h1>
50+
<p>The server can not find the requested page</p>
51+
</div>
52+
</div>
53+
<body>
3554
</html>

dist/ffmpeg-core.wasm

Lines changed: 53 additions & 34 deletions
Original file line numberDiff line numberDiff line change
@@ -1,35 +1,54 @@
1-
<!doctype html>
2-
<html>
3-
<head>
4-
<meta charset="utf-8">
5-
<meta name="robots" content="noindex, nofollow">
6-
<title>One moment, please...</title>
7-
<style>
8-
body {
9-
background: #F6F7F8;
10-
color: #303131;
11-
font-family: sans-serif;
12-
margin-top: 45vh;
13-
text-align: center;
14-
}
15-
</style>
16-
</head>
17-
<body>
18-
<h1>Please wait while your request is being verified...</h1>
19-
<form id="wsidchk-form" style="display:none;" action="/z0f76a1d14fd21a8fb5fd0d03e0fdc3d3cedae52f" method="get">
20-
<input type="hidden" id="wsidchk" name="wsidchk"/>
21-
</form>
22-
<script>
23-
(function(){
24-
var west=+((+!+[])+(+!+[]+!![]+!![]+!![]+[])+(+![])+(+!+[]+!![]+[])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![])+(+!+[]+[])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![])+(+!+[]+!![]+[])),
25-
east=+((+!+[])+(+!+[]+!![]+!![]+[])+(+!+[]+!![]+!![])+(+!+[]+!![]+[])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![]+[])+(+!+[])+(+!+[]+!![]+!![]+!![]+!![]+[])),
26-
x=function(){try{return !!window.addEventListener;}catch(e){return !!0;} },
27-
y=function(y,z){x() ? document.addEventListener("DOMContentLoaded",y,z) : document.attachEvent("onreadystatechange",y);};
28-
y(function(){
29-
document.getElementById('wsidchk').value = west + east;
30-
document.getElementById('wsidchk-form').submit();
31-
}, false);
32-
})();
33-
</script>
34-
</body>
1+
2+
3+
4+
<!DOCTYPE html>
5+
<html>
6+
<head>
7+
<title>404 Not Found</title>
8+
<meta http-equiv="Content-type" content="text/html; charset=utf-8">
9+
<meta http-equiv="Cache-control" content="no-cache">
10+
<meta http-equiv="Pragma" content="no-cache">
11+
<meta http-equiv="Expires" content="0">
12+
<link rel="shortcut icon" href="/favicon.ico" type="image/x-icon">
13+
<link rel="icon" href="/favicon.ico" type="image/x-icon">
14+
<style type="text/css">
15+
html, body {
16+
height: 100%;
17+
margin: 0;
18+
}
19+
body {
20+
color: yellow;
21+
background: black url(img/soviet-logo.png) no-repeat center center;
22+
}
23+
.overlay {
24+
width: 100%;
25+
height: 100%;
26+
background-color: rgba(0, 0, 0, .75);
27+
}
28+
.error {
29+
position: fixed;
30+
top: 50%;
31+
left: 50%;
32+
transform: translateX(-50%) translateY(-50%);
33+
font-family: Arial, Helvetica, sans-serif;
34+
text-align: center;
35+
}
36+
.error h1 {
37+
margin: 0;
38+
font-size: 2rem;
39+
}
40+
.error p {
41+
margin: 0;
42+
margin-top: 1rem;
43+
}
44+
</style>
45+
</head>
46+
<body>
47+
<div class="overlay">
48+
<div class="error">
49+
<h1>404 Not Found</h1>
50+
<p>The server can not find the requested page</p>
51+
</div>
52+
</div>
53+
<body>
3554
</html>

dist/ffmpeg.min.js

Lines changed: 2 additions & 35 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

dist/fsalib.min.js

Lines changed: 1 addition & 35 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

dist/ra2web.min.js

Lines changed: 115 additions & 35 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

dist/vendor.bundle.min.js

Lines changed: 1 addition & 35 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

dist/workerHost.min.js

Lines changed: 1 addition & 35 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

dist/workerVxl.js

Lines changed: 1 addition & 35 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

index.html

Lines changed: 119 additions & 31 deletions
Original file line numberDiff line numberDiff line change
@@ -1,35 +1,123 @@
1-
<!doctype html>
1+
<!DOCTYPE html>
22
<html>
33
<head>
4-
<meta charset="utf-8">
5-
<meta name="robots" content="noindex, nofollow">
6-
<title>One moment, please...</title>
7-
<style>
8-
body {
9-
background: #F6F7F8;
10-
color: #303131;
11-
font-family: sans-serif;
12-
margin-top: 45vh;
13-
text-align: center;
14-
}
15-
</style>
4+
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
5+
<meta name="viewport" content="width=device-width, initial-scale=0.4">
6+
<meta name="description" content="An unofficial remake of the classic &quot;Command &amp; Conquer: Red Alert 2&quot; RTS game, playable online in the web browser." />
7+
<title>Red Alert 2: Chrono Divide</title>
8+
<script type="text/javascript">
9+
var browserSupported = true;
10+
try {
11+
eval("'use strict'; class C { async test(...args) { let spread = {...({a: 2})} }}");
12+
var canvas = document.createElement('canvas');
13+
browserSupported = !!(
14+
window.WebGLRenderingContext && (canvas.getContext('webgl') || canvas.getContext('experimental-webgl')) &&
15+
new Blob(["test"], { type: "text/plain" }).arrayBuffer
16+
);
17+
} catch (e) {
18+
browserSupported = false;
19+
}
20+
if (!browserSupported) {
21+
alert("Browser not supported.\n\nPlease download the latest Google Chrome, Mozilla Firefox or Microsoft Edge.");
22+
}
23+
</script>
24+
25+
<!-- Global site tag (gtag.js) - Google Analytics -->
26+
<script async src="https://www.googletagmanager.com/gtag/js?id=G-NT498QGSGZ"></script>
27+
<script>
28+
window.dataLayer = window.dataLayer || [];
29+
function gtag(){dataLayer.push(arguments);}
30+
gtag('js', new Date());
31+
32+
gtag('config', 'G-NT498QGSGZ');
33+
</script>
34+
35+
<link href="res/fonts/fonts.css" rel="stylesheet"></link>
36+
<link rel="stylesheet" href="style.css?v=0.56.0" type="text/css"></link>
37+
<style type="text/css">
38+
#ra2web-root {
39+
position: relative;
40+
}
41+
</style>
1642
</head>
17-
<body>
18-
<h1>Please wait while your request is being verified...</h1>
19-
<form id="wsidchk-form" style="display:none;" action="/z0f76a1d14fd21a8fb5fd0d03e0fdc3d3cedae52f" method="get">
20-
<input type="hidden" id="wsidchk" name="wsidchk"/>
21-
</form>
22-
<script>
23-
(function(){
24-
var west=+((+!+[]+!![]+!![]+!![]+!![]+!![])+(+!+[]+!![]+[])+(+!+[]+!![])+(+!+[]+!![]+!![]+[])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![]+!![])+(+!+[]+!![]+[])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![])),
25-
east=+((+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+!![])+(+!+[]+!![]+!![]+[])+(+!+[]+!![]+!![]+!![])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![]+[])+(+!+[]+!![]+!![])+(+![]+[])+(+!+[]+!![]+!![]+!![]+!![]+!![]+!![])),
26-
x=function(){try{return !!window.addEventListener;}catch(e){return !!0;} },
27-
y=function(y,z){x() ? document.addEventListener("DOMContentLoaded",y,z) : document.attachEvent("onreadystatechange",y);};
28-
y(function(){
29-
document.getElementById('wsidchk').value = west + east;
30-
document.getElementById('wsidchk-form').submit();
31-
}, false);
32-
})();
33-
</script>
43+
<body class="no-js">
44+
<div id="loader-wrapper" style="display: none;">
45+
<div id="loader"></div>
46+
<div id="loader-logo"></div>
47+
</div>
48+
49+
<div id="ra2web-root"></div>
50+
51+
<script type="text/javascript">
52+
if (browserSupported) {
53+
document.body.classList.remove("no-js");
54+
setTimeout(() => {
55+
let loader = document.getElementById("loader-wrapper");
56+
if (loader) {
57+
loader.style.display = "";
58+
}
59+
}, 2000);
60+
}
61+
</script>
62+
<script type="text/javascript" src="lib/system.js"></script>
63+
<script type="text/javascript" src="lib/three.min.js?v0.94"></script>
64+
<script type="text/javascript" src="lib/three/three.shader-patch.js?v=2"></script>
65+
<script type="text/javascript" src="lib/three/three.octree.js?v=2"></script>
66+
<script type="text/javascript" src="lib/three/SimplexNoise.js"></script>
67+
<script type="text/javascript" src="lib/three/LightningStrike.js"></script>
68+
<script type="text/javascript" src="lib/three/TrailRenderer.js"></script>
69+
<script type="text/javascript" src="lib/three/SPE.min.js"></script>
70+
<script type="text/javascript" src="lib/three/SPE.patch.js"></script>
71+
<script type="text/javascript" src="lib/growingpacker.js"></script>
72+
<script type="text/javascript" src="lib/lzo1x.js"></script>
73+
<script type="text/javascript" src="lib/fullscreen-api-polyfill.min.js"></script>
74+
<script type="text/javascript" src="dist/ra2web.min.js?v=0.56.0"></script>
75+
<script type="text/javascript" src="dist/vendor.bundle.min.js?v=0.56.0"></script>
76+
<script type="text/javascript" src="dist/workerHost.min.js?v=0.56.0"></script>
77+
<script type="text/javascript">
78+
SystemJS.config({
79+
packages: {
80+
"@puzzl": {
81+
defaultExtension: "js"
82+
},
83+
"@puzzl/core/lib/async/cancellation": {
84+
main: "index.js"
85+
},
86+
"@babel/runtime": {
87+
defaultExtension: "js"
88+
},
89+
"@babel/runtime/regenerator": {
90+
main: "index.js"
91+
},
92+
"regenerator-runtime": {
93+
main: "runtime.js"
94+
}
95+
},
96+
meta: {
97+
"web-audio-polyfill.js": {
98+
scriptLoad: true
99+
},
100+
"dist/7zz.js": {
101+
scriptLoad: true
102+
},
103+
"dist/fsalib.min.js": {
104+
scriptLoad: true
105+
}
106+
},
107+
paths: {
108+
"web-audio-polyfill.js": "dist/web-audio-polyfill.min.js",
109+
"7z-wasm": "dist/7zz.js",
110+
"@ffmpeg/ffmpeg": "dist/ffmpeg.min.js",
111+
"file-system-access": "dist/fsalib.min.js?v=1.0.4",
112+
}
113+
})
114+
System.registerDynamic('three', [], false, function(require, exports, module) {
115+
module.exports = window.THREE;
116+
});
117+
if (browserSupported) {
118+
SystemJS.import("main");
119+
document.body.removeChild(document.getElementById("loader-wrapper"));
120+
}
121+
</script>
34122
</body>
35-
</html>
123+
</html>

0 commit comments

Comments
 (0)